Webb24 dec. 2012 · Introduction. Transient ischaemic attack (TIA) is a significant public health problem. Despite knowledge on the incidence of stroke in Australia, 1 the true incidence of TIA in the Australian community remains poorly understood. Webb11 feb. 2024 · OH is common in patients presenting to a TIA clinic, with one study citing a prevalence of 24% in patients diagnosed with TIA/stroke and even 20% in those without a TIA/stroke diagnosis .
